Home
last modified time | relevance | path

Searched refs:pidx (Results 1 – 6 of 6) sorted by relevance

/optee_os/core/drivers/clk/
H A Dclk.c89 struct clk *clk_get_parent_by_index(struct clk *clk, size_t pidx) in clk_get_parent_by_index() argument
91 if (pidx >= clk->num_parents) in clk_get_parent_by_index()
94 return clk->parents[pidx]; in clk_get_parent_by_index()
99 size_t pidx = 0; in clk_init_parent() local
108 pidx = clk->ops->get_parent(clk); in clk_init_parent()
109 assert(pidx < clk->num_parents); in clk_init_parent()
111 clk->parent = clk->parents[pidx]; in clk_init_parent()
271 size_t *pidx) in clk_get_parent_idx() argument
277 *pidx = i; in clk_get_parent_idx()
287 size_t pidx) in clk_set_parent_no_lock() argument
[all …]
H A Dclk-stm32-core.c359 static TEE_Result clk_stm32_mux_set_parent(struct clk *clk, size_t pidx) in clk_stm32_mux_set_parent() argument
363 return stm32_mux_set_parent(cfg->mux_id, pidx); in clk_stm32_mux_set_parent()
449 TEE_Result clk_stm32_composite_set_parent(struct clk *clk, size_t pidx) in clk_stm32_composite_set_parent() argument
456 return stm32_mux_set_parent(cfg->mux_id, pidx); in clk_stm32_composite_set_parent()
506 TEE_Result clk_stm32_set_parent_by_index(struct clk *clk, size_t pidx) in clk_stm32_set_parent_by_index() argument
508 struct clk *parent = clk_get_parent_by_index(clk, pidx); in clk_stm32_set_parent_by_index()
H A Dclk-stm32-core.h150 TEE_Result clk_stm32_composite_set_parent(struct clk *clk, size_t pidx);
158 TEE_Result clk_stm32_set_parent_by_index(struct clk *clk, size_t pidx);
H A Dclk-stm32mp25.c2246 size_t pidx = 0; in clk_stm32_pll3_enable() local
2259 pidx = clk_stm32_pll_get_parent(clk); in clk_stm32_pll3_enable()
2260 parent = clk_get_parent_by_index(clk, pidx); in clk_stm32_pll3_enable()
2295 static TEE_Result clk_stm32_flexgen_set_parent(struct clk *clk, size_t pidx) in clk_stm32_flexgen_set_parent() argument
2302 RCC_XBAR0CFGR_XBAR0SEL_MASK, pidx); in clk_stm32_flexgen_set_parent()
H A Dclk-stm32mp21.c2263 static TEE_Result clk_stm32_flexgen_set_parent(struct clk *clk, size_t pidx) in clk_stm32_flexgen_set_parent() argument
2271 RCC_XBAR0CFGR_XBAR0SEL_MASK, pidx); in clk_stm32_flexgen_set_parent()
/optee_os/core/include/drivers/
H A Dclk.h203 struct clk *clk_get_parent_by_index(struct clk *clk, size_t pidx);